What can you do to get your PC to recognize drives that previously worked after you have removed all computer viruses?

[Edit]

Answer

No software (such as a virus) can cause physical damage to your hard drive. If the virus was the original cause of the drive failing to be recognised. Erradication of the virus and it's incidental effects would restore the drive to it's original operating state. However it's possible the virus didn't cause your drive to become hidden, it may have just worn out.
